Scope and Purpose

  • Identify business opportunities and growth strategies across rating and corporate debt advisory
  • Actively contribute to origination activities, mainly in coordination with Debt Origination and Industry coverage, proactively identifying the needs of corporate clients through in-depth financial analysis and strategic evaluations
  • Lead or supervise the execution of rating and corporate debt advisory mandates, building and maintaining strong relationships with key stakeholders, and supporting clients in their interactions with all relevant counterparties (e.g. rating agencies, advisors, banks
  • Provide leadership, coordination, and mentoring to junior team members, fostering continuous learning and professional development
  • Stay constantly updated on market dynamics, industry trends and regulatory developments in the corporate space.

Required Experience

  • The candidate brings at least 10 years of professional experience in investment banking or top-tier advisory firms, gained in senior roles as rating, debt or financial advisor across corporate transactions, both in Italy and internationally
  • The candidate has gained a multi-year experience and familiarity with the Italian/European mid-large corporate market, including both IG and sub-IG credits
  • A proven track record in independently managing complex projects or client mandates is essential. Direct experience with/at rating agencies or a track record on rating-driven deals, will be considered a strong plus.

Competencies Required

  • The role requires strong analytical thinking, ability to summarize key credit drivers and build robust financial models. A deep understanding of financial statements, debt structures, and credit documentation — including covenants and key ratios — is essential. We value candidates who are able to translate technical analysis into clear, actionable insights to support strategic decision-making. Familiarity with rating methodologies, as well as hybrid debt instruments, is considered a strong plus
  • The candidate is expected to convey technical content in a clear and structured way — both in writing and orally — adapting messages to different audiences. A client-oriented mindset and the capacity to foster long-term, trust-based relationships are critical, along with a proactive approach in anticipating client needs and supporting commercial development
  • A strong command of financial modelling tools is required. The candidate must be proficient in Excel and PowerPoint. Familiarity with financial databases (e.g. Bloomberg, Capital IQ, Refinitiv) to support analysis, benchmarking and market screening will be considered an asset. A genuine curiosity toward technological innovation in the financial advisory space is also expected
  • Fluency in both Italian and English is required
  • Master’s degree in Economics or Engineering (preferably with a specialization in finance and financial markets). MBA, CFA or other qualifications will be considered an asset.
